Deep-link routing, Harrowgate mobile app. Before each release: verify the route manifest matches the shipped binary — mismatches send users to the fallback web view. Run the link-validation job against staging; all 34 registered patterns must resolve. New routes require entries in both the iOS and Android manifests plus the universal-link config. Do not ship if validation shows orphaned patterns. The manifest, validation job, and rollback steps are documented here.

wiki page, tahaf-tajog: https://jira.ordindyn.corp/pipeline

# Splitgate Assignment Service — Environments

Splitgate runs in three environments: dev, staging, and prod. Dev uses synthetic traffic only; staging mirrors prod assignment rules with a 24-hour delay; prod serves live experiment bucketing for all Nimbrella apps. Each environment has its own hashing salt and flag store, so assignments never leak across tiers. The per-environment configuration is as follows.

service settings:
WENATH_PIN=5007
WENATH_METRICS_HOST=metrics.wenath.tolvaqlabs.corp
WENATH_LOG_LEVEL=debug
WENATH_TENANT=rusox

**09:47 — Sweeper misclassification confirmed.** The Hollowmere orphaned-resource sweeper flagged active storage volumes in the Pellan region as unowned, due to a tag-sync lag from the inventory service. Deletion was queued but not executed; the safety hold engaged as designed. Affected volumes were re-tagged and the sweeper paused pending a fix. The build token of the sweeper release under review appears below.

session token of kageg-tahop = htk14_af3c1ccccb7dcf

Subject: Handover — cron drift on Pellwick

Hi — handing over the cron drift investigation on the Pellwick replicas. Short version: the nightly vacuum job slips roughly four minutes per week, and we suspect NTP on the standby host. Timing logs are in the `ops_schedule` table. You can query it directly on the maintenance replica using the string below.

replica DSN, kajep-yahag: mssql://praok_svc:iF@db-8d68.plorvaio.local:5432/eliion